智能邮件管理新方案:邮件意图分类助手设计与实践

一、邮件意图分类的核心价值与场景

在数字化办公场景中,企业每天需处理海量邮件,其中包含投诉、咨询、订单确认、合作洽谈等数十种意图类型。传统人工分类效率低下,错误率高,而邮件意图分类助手通过自然语言处理技术,可自动识别邮件核心意图,实现快速分类与路由。典型应用场景包括:

  • 客服系统:自动将投诉邮件转至工单系统,咨询邮件转至知识库
  • 销售管理:识别潜在客户合作意向,触发跟进流程
  • 合规审查:检测违规内容或敏感信息,自动触发预警

据统计,自动化分类可使邮件处理效率提升60%以上,人工成本降低40%。其技术核心在于对邮件文本的语义理解与上下文推理能力。

二、技术架构设计与实现路径

1. 模型选型与比较

当前主流技术方案包括规则引擎、传统机器学习与深度学习三类:

  • 规则引擎:基于关键词匹配(如”退款”、”投诉”),适用于简单场景,但泛化能力弱
  • 传统机器学习:使用TF-IDF+SVM/随机森林,需人工特征工程,对复杂语义处理不足
  • 深度学习:BERT、RoBERTa等预训练模型,可捕捉上下文依赖,准确率更高

以BERT为例,其双向Transformer结构能有效处理长文本依赖。测试数据显示,在10分类任务中,BERT微调模型准确率可达92%,较传统方法提升15个百分点。

2. 数据处理关键步骤

数据质量直接影响模型性能,需重点关注:

  • 数据清洗:去除HTML标签、特殊符号,统一编码格式
  • 标注规范:制定三级分类体系(如一级:业务咨询/投诉/其他;二级:产品咨询/流程咨询)
  • 数据增强:通过同义词替换、回译生成增加样本多样性

示例数据预处理代码(Python):

  1. import re
  2. from zh_core_web_sm import Chinese # 中文NLP工具包
  3. def clean_email(text):
  4. # 去除HTML标签
  5. text = re.sub(r'<[^>]+>', '', text)
  6. # 去除多余空格
  7. text = ' '.join(text.split())
  8. # 中文分词(可选)
  9. nlp = Chinese()
  10. doc = nlp(text)
  11. return ' '.join([token.text for token in doc])

3. 模型训练与优化

以BERT微调为例,关键参数配置:

  • 学习率:2e-5(预训练模型微调推荐值)
  • Batch Size:32(根据GPU内存调整)
  • Epoch:3-5(防止过拟合)
  • 损失函数:交叉熵损失

训练优化技巧:

  • 使用学习率预热(Linear Warmup)
  • 添加Dropout层(概率0.1)防止过拟合
  • 采用Focal Loss处理类别不平衡问题

三、部署与性能优化方案

1. 部署架构选择

  • 单机部署:适用于中小型企业,使用Flask/FastAPI构建RESTful API
  • 分布式部署:高并发场景下,采用Kubernetes容器化部署,配合负载均衡
  • 边缘计算:对延迟敏感场景,可在本地网关部署轻量级模型

2. 性能优化策略

  • 模型压缩:使用知识蒸馏将BERT压缩至1/10参数量,推理速度提升5倍
  • 缓存机制:对高频查询邮件建立缓存,减少重复计算
  • 异步处理:非实时任务采用消息队列(如RabbitMQ)异步处理

性能测试数据(某企业实测):
| 方案 | 准确率 | 响应时间 | 硬件成本 |
|———————-|————|—————|—————|
| 原始BERT | 92% | 800ms | 高 |
| 蒸馏后模型 | 89% | 150ms | 中 |
| 规则引擎 | 75% | 20ms | 低 |

四、最佳实践与注意事项

1. 实施路线图建议

  1. 需求分析:明确分类粒度(如2级/3级分类)、响应时间要求
  2. 数据准备:收集至少5000条标注数据,覆盖主要业务场景
  3. 模型选型:根据资源情况选择BERT变体(如ALBERT、TinyBERT)
  4. 迭代优化:建立AB测试机制,持续监控模型衰减情况

2. 常见问题处理

  • 领域适应:金融、医疗等垂直领域需进行领域预训练
  • 多语言支持:采用mBERT或多语言模型处理外文邮件
  • 对抗样本:添加噪声数据训练提升鲁棒性

3. 评估指标体系

除准确率外,需重点关注:

  • F1-Score:处理类别不平衡问题
  • AUC-ROC:评估模型整体排序能力
  • 平均处理时间(APT):衡量系统吞吐量

五、未来技术演进方向

  1. 多模态分类:结合邮件附件(PDF/图片)进行联合分析
  2. 实时意图识别:在邮件撰写阶段预测发送方意图
  3. 主动学习:自动筛选高价值样本供人工标注,降低标注成本
  4. 小样本学习:基于Meta-Learning实现快速领域适配

当前,某云厂商已推出基于预训练大模型的邮件分类解决方案,支持零代码部署,可将实施周期从数周缩短至数天。对于技术团队,建议优先验证BERT系列模型在自身数据上的表现,再逐步探索更先进的架构。


通过系统化的技术选型、严谨的数据处理流程和针对性的性能优化,邮件意图分类助手可显著提升企业邮件处理效率。实际部署时,需根据业务规模、硬件条件和准确率要求进行动态调整,持续迭代模型以适应语言习惯变化。